揭秘清华女学霸在蚂蚁当程序员的真实写照:野狼Disco与代码更配哦

简介: “保送清华”“蚂蚁技术布道师”“代码写嗨了就来首野狼Disco”……支付宝这位女程序员有点意思

这位保送清华的女程序员有点意思:外表如此乖张可人,内心却极度追求理性、渴望变化与挑战,代码写嗨时还会来首《野狼Disco》,一边听还会跟着音乐动起来。她就是蚂蚁技术布道师王君,3月18日下午14:00她与你在直播间不见不散,看看SeverlessSQL如何提升研发效能,将开发同学从繁琐的运维工作中解放出来~

习惯性多线程并行的清华学霸

王君本科就读于湖南大学,后被保送至清华大学软件工程专业读研。目前在蚂蚁金服负责数据库统一配置与容灾管理的相关业务。

走技术这条路,她从未迟疑过:“像我这样理性思维比较强的人,就比较适合像计算机专业这样比较确定性的事务。”而王君选择计算机专业还有另一个很重要的因素:喜欢挑战。

为了走出舒适圈,王君从上一家工作强度没那么大的公司辞职来到了蚂蚁,刚开始也曾陷入DDS、DSS、XTS等产品名字记混、工作节奏快、工作强度高、前沿技术需要不断钻研等困境,但慢慢的,自己的工作有了产出,比如参与开发了SeverlessSQL部分功能和实现,就逐渐在工作上找到了成就感。

平时,为了获取最新的技术知识,王君经常会去网上找一些相关论文看,有一次找演草纸的时候,在办公桌一摞纸中突然发现标题很眼熟,原来同事和她在看一样的内容。

有一群志同道合的同事一起让王君觉得工作非常幸福,她眼中的同事是同甘共苦的战士,她认为蚂蚁金服的同事和自己一样非常有主观能动性,自驱力都很强。比如在疫情期间,大家在家办公与在公司办公没什么区别,都会保证项目的时间节点,由于少了通勤时间效率反而比在公司更高。

“大一开始学软件工程的时候,老师就告诉了我们永远不变的就是需求一直在变。”在蚂蚁,面对不确定性和技术日新月异的变化,所有人都积极拥抱变化,学习新技能。

“写代码写的比较嗨的时候,会听《野狼Disco》”

9点起床,钉钉上打卡,泡一杯咖啡,王君多线程并发的一天就开始了。

9:30开会,与同事对接需求、实现需求,或者对产品进行在线答疑。这是疫情期间王君在家办公的日常。每天都是多线程工作,充实、高效率。生活中的她也执行不忘时时刻刻贯彻多线程高效率并行主义。

空余时间王君一般会宅在家里刷中文剧,她有一个特殊的习惯,就是不能纯看剧,看剧时喜欢同时进行另一件事情,她觉得这样在同一段时光里时间被double了,很有成就感。平时还会玩一些积木拼搭的玩具,这次疫情期间她除了在家办公外还搭了很多类似乐高的微缩材料的拼搭,有空时她还会画一些油画。

高强度的工作节奏迫使王君去找到生活和工作的平衡点。她说:“生活本来就是要这样(忙碌)才会在偶尔放松的时候会感觉自己生活有意义吧。”

拥抱变化的王君对技术的喜爱没有变过,“写代码写的比较嗨的时候,会听《野狼Disco》,身体也会不由自主的跟着运动起来。”书山有路勤为径,代码无涯苦作舟。

在蚂蚁金服将近一年,她确实找到了更大的技术成长空间,找回了自我驱动、自我成长的状态。“每天的工作内容就是搞需求、写代码、测试、交付、值班答疑,丰富而又饱满!”如今面对技术上的疑问,她已经可以应对自如。

“(产品)如果有人用才能够使我们的技术更好向前发展,起到一个相互促进的作用。”王君在蚂蚁金服还有一个重要的身份便是技术布道师,对于能够参与到中国基础软件建设她发自内心地感到自豪,她觉得好的技术没有被更多人知道使用,是一种浪费,她希望能够有更多机会宣传优秀的技术和产品。

Severless(无服务架构)去年开始在国内流行,各大厂商都开始进行相应布局,在云原生时代,软件高效的持续交付过程是开发重要的一个环节,Severless的出现提高了运维效能,将开发同学从繁琐的运维工作中解放出来。但是面对新技术每个厂商都有自己的不同的理解,SeverlessSQL是蚂蚁金服研发的一款用SQL操作物理库表资源结构及数据中间件配置的产品,王君参与开发了SeverlessSQL部分功能和实现。

“SeverlessSQL的目标是希望能够通过代码的配置化定义去解决研发过程中一些比较复杂的环节。”王君强调就是从研发效能着手让开发同学能够更加专注于业务逻辑本身,实际上SeverlessSQL可以看作是DevOps的进一步发展,比如一个项目依赖多个数据源信息,根据流程要申请库填配置信息,过去DevOps便是要实现各种能力都用工具集成,到不同平台和不同的数据源负责人沟通申请,在项目发展过程中,会推进不同的环境,每个环境都要再去建一遍,但是当应用功能越来越多,越来越复杂,这种方法就非常影响研发效能。SeverlessSQL可以通过代码配置解决这些问题,无论Ops工具发展到何种程度,开发者只要明确想要什么,用规范的语言定义出来,SeverlessSQL都能够帮他实现所有的下层复杂逻辑。“我们把简单留给了大家,把复杂下沉到了底部。”

疫情期间,蚂蚁金服开设了技术抗疫的系列直播课程,王君作为技术布道师也欣然接受了讲课任务,选择了她熟悉的SeverlessSQL进行讲解。 3月18日蚂蚁金服中间件小姐姐王君将带来“蚂蚁SeverlessSQL研发效能实践解析”课程,手把手带你体验轻量级和短平快的研发过程,了解SeverlessSQL实践之路,帮助你深入解析SeverlessSQL如何提升研发效能。

描二维码或点击链接,即可观看直播~

相关文章
mqc
|
缓存 安全 Java
测试之道--阿里巴巴八年测试专家倾情奉献
我从事测试工作将近八年了,从起初的不懂测试,怀疑测试,到相信测试,再到坚定测试,其中经历的辛酸、煎熬无法言表。在从事测试工作的这八年里,有人质疑,也有人追捧,唇枪舌剑,没完没了,貌似测试永远都是个站在舆论风口浪尖的角色。
mqc
7786 0
|
7月前
|
消息中间件 分布式计算 Kubernetes
爆款阿里P5到P7晋升之路,九大源码文档助我超神果然努力幸运并存
前言 相信有许多的程序员,工作了这么多年;但是依然不知道自己掌握的技术栈+项目,究竟达到了阿里的什么职级,还有薪资水平是什么样的;
|
9月前
|
消息中间件 缓存 负载均衡
阿里技术团队编写的对标金九银十大厂面试指南又在git上火了
又要到金九银十了,每年9、10月份各大互联网公司都会周期性地发生人事变动,无论是刚进社会的职场小白,还是准备跳槽的“外卖员”,都会争取在这个时候获得新工作,或迎来晋升涨薪的最佳机会。 写下这篇文章没有别的意义,就单纯的分享一份阿里技术团队(权威性不言而喻)整合的对标金九银十的面试指南文档,希望能助力各位“格子衫骑手”,在面向金九银十时起到一定的帮助作用。
|
10月前
|
算法 C语言
【CSDN编程竞赛·第四期】个人参赛经历和个人建议
大家好,我前不久参加了官方举办的CSDN编程比赛,官方举办了四期,第一期的时候没看到,错过了,后面的每一期我都参加了,总的感觉来说,还可以。下面我具体说说第四期相关经验吧。
82 0
|
11月前
|
存储 JavaScript Java
|
安全 编译器 程序员
【C++修炼之路】1. 初窥门径(二)
【C++修炼之路】1. 初窥门径(二)
【C++修炼之路】1. 初窥门径(二)
|
存储 分布式计算 自然语言处理
【C++修炼之路】1. 初窥门径(一)
【C++修炼之路】1. 初窥门径(一)
【C++修炼之路】1. 初窥门径(一)
|
开发框架 Rust 监控
QCon 2022·上海站 | 学习笔记3: 字节跳动在 Rust 方向的探索和实践
QCon 2022·上海站 | 学习笔记3: 字节跳动在 Rust 方向的探索和实践
422 0
|
Oracle NoSQL 关系型数据库
十年前,他如何自学技术进阿里?
阿里云高级DBA专家玄惭,讲述十年前通过校招加入阿里的经历和心得,希望对大家有所帮助
十年前,他如何自学技术进阿里?